WebIn the Extended Parental Benefits 18 month model, the initial 15 weeks maternity leave remains the same; 55% of your salary up to $562/week. Following that, parents or caregivers receive 33% of their salary for up to 61 weeks, to a maximum of $337/week (which can be increased if you qualify for the Family Supplement). WebMy understanding is that the date you communicate to EI and the date you communicate to your employer are independent from each other. You can't switch from 12 month to 18 month leave for EI because the payments differ and you're locked into one payment or the other, but you are legally entitled to take up to 18 months leave from your employer.

WebThese periods are: standard parental: within 52 weeks (12 months) extended parental: within 78 weeks (18 months) Before you apply, consider carefully whether standard or extended parental benefits are better for you.
